Understanding Car Key Fobs


A car key fob is an electronic gadget that permits users to control their vehicle's locking and opening systems, alarm, and in many cases, ignition. Numerous kinds of car key fobs exist in the market, which influence the replacement process and expenses included.

Types of Car Key Fobs

Here are some common types of car key fobs:

  1. Standard Key Fobs:

    • Basic locking and unlocking functions.
    • No transponder chip.
  2. Transponder Key Fobs:

    • Contains a transponder chip for included security.
    • Requires programs to match the vehicle.
  3. Smart Key Fobs:

    • Keyless entry and ignition systems.
    • Uses distance sensors for operation.
  4. Switchblade Key Fobs:

    • Combination of a standard key and a remote.
    • Key folds into the fob, supplying compactness.
  5. Smartphone-Controlled Fobs:

    • Allow control of the vehicle through mobile applications.
    • Can incorporate extra functions, such as remote start.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)


1. The length of time does it take to replace a car key fob?

The time taken to replace a car key fob differs by provider. It can take anywhere from a couple of minutes to a couple of hours, specifically if programs is required.

2. Can I replace my key fob myself?

Yes, some key fobs can be programmed in the house. However, more sophisticated fobs normally need expert programming.

3. What if my key fob is lost or stolen?

If your key fob is lost or taken, it is recommended to replace it right away for security factors. Furthermore, think about getting the vehicle's locks rekeyed to prevent unapproved gain access to.

4. How can I extend the battery life of my key fob?

To extend the battery life, avoid keeping the fob near magnets, and replace the battery as quickly as you notice indications of weakening (e.g., unresponsive buttons).
